Produktinformationen "Low Carbon Materials and Technologies for a Sustainable and Resilient Infrastructure"
This book presents select proceedings of the International Conference on Cement and Building Koncrete infrastructure for sustainability and Resilience (CBKR-2023). It discusses the latest technologies and innovative and non-conventional materials for sustainable built environment. The topics covered include alternate, sustainable, cost-effective, and smart materials and technologies. It also covers applications of artificial intelligence and machine learning in construction, MCDM techniques, performance-based design, and 3D printing technologies. The book is useful for researchers and professionals in the area of civil engineering and materials science.
